Link ECU Technical Information

The CAN Lambda’s ability to measure the proportion of oxygen in exhaust gases makes it an essential tool for accurately tuning fuel mixtures as well allowing your ECU to make tuning adjustments on the fly.

Being fully digital the CAN Lambda’s powerful LSU 4.9 sensor will eliminate any loss of signal, risk, delays and errors that analogue alternatives cause. The CAN-Lambda never requires free air calibration.

Box Contents

  • CAN-Lambda device
  • Bosch LSU4.9 Sensor
  • Deutsch 4-Way Connector Kit
  • O2 Bung and Plug
  • 2 Large Stickers
  • 2 Small Stickers
  • Quick Start Quide

Link’s CAN Lambda is an easy to use CAN module that provides digital wideband sensor control via CAN bus and is compatible with leading aftermarket ECUs.

If using the CAN Lambda with a G4+/G4X PlugIn ECU use a Link CANPCB cable to access the CAN port on the PlugIn PCB and a Link CANF field insertable CAN plug.

Please note proper CAN protocol must be followed. See manual below for guidance.
